Tunisia - Import of Fuel, Lubricating and Cooling Pumps for Motor Engines
Since 2014, Tunisia Import of Fuel, Lubricating and Cooling Pumps for Motor Engines was down by 2%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 62 comparing other countries in Import of Fuel, Lubricating and Cooling Pumps for Motor Engines with $9,086,288.8. Tunisia is overtaken by Ghana, which was number 61 with $9,431,083 and is followed by Guatemala at $8,927,239. United States ranked the highest with $2,794,196,091.22 in 2019, an increase of 1.6% versus 2018. Germany, China and Mexico resp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Burundi recorded the best 5 years average growth at +88.6% per year, while Mauritania witnessed the worst performance at -47.2% per year.
